Since 1990, Vanguard has grown as a producer of illustrated, pop culture publications. Vanguard shifted from periodicals to mostly book publication in the late-90s, shortly before beginning their long affiliation with Random House subsidiary, Watson-Guptill Publications. Vanguard subjects include, art, fantasy, graphic novels, prints, science fiction, music, mystery, and more. They are also known as the world's leading producer of art-book biographies on illustrators & cartoonists. Vanguard has garnered acclaim from The New York Times, The Village Voice, Time Out New York, The IPPY Awards, Starlog, National Public Radio, Video Watchdog, The Eisner Awards, Entertainment Weekly, Fangoria, The Society of Illustrators, Rue Morgue, Amazon.com, Publishers Weekly, Variety, The Locus Awards, Library Journal, The Rondo Awards, and more.

Vanguard Publishing celebrated their 17th consecutive year at Comic-Con International: San Diego, in style, with the help of some famous friends. The festivities included appearances, all weekend, by revolutionary Captain America, X-Men, and Nick Fury Agent of S.H.I.E.L.D. artist-writer Jim Steranko. The Comics Hall of Fame talent is also known for his career as an escape artist which helped inspire both, the Pulitzer winning novel The Amazing Adventures of Kavalier & Clay by Michael Chabon, as well as the character Mister Miracle by Jack Kirby. Steranko’s work with top film directors Steven Spielberg, Francis Ford Coppola, George Lucas include Raiders of the Lost Ark, Bram Stoker’s Dracula and more. During the Comic-Con Steranko also promoted the new illustrated novel, Conspiricy of the Planet of the Apes which sports an iconic new Steranko cover painting.

Emmy Award-nominee and ground-breaking Elektra Assassin, New Mutants, Stray Toasters, and Voodoo Child: The illustrated Legend of Jimi Hendrix graphic novelist, Bill Sienkiewicz spent most of the convention signing autographs and sketching for fans at the Vanguard booth. Sienkiewicz is also noted for his work on the innovative Vanguard series The EDGE.™

Horror fans were also thrilled with the Vanguard appearance of Bela Lugosi Jr. who was signing copies of The Famous Monster Movie Art of Basil Gogos, the new Monsterverse comic Bela Lugosi’s Tales from the Grave, and promoting the new Lugosi line of red wines!

Vanguard also featured a special exhibit of works by the late, great fantasy art icon, Frank Frazetta. On March, 8, 2010, Frazetta Management and Vanguard Publishing had announced that Frank Frazetta, and the family company, Frazetta Properties LLC had entered a new publishing relationship and launched the Vanguard Frazetta Classics line of books. At the time of that announcement, the legendary artist said, “We’ve known Vanguard publisher J. David Spurlock for many years. It’s a natural that we should work together. I’m looking forward to seeing the quality job they do on the new Frazetta books.” Frazetta paintings, which have ever rose in value, have sold for 1-1.5 million dollars in recent years. Sadly, in 2010, news spread the world over that, the grand master of fantastic art had passed away following a massive stroke. To honor the artist, Vanguard founder J. David Spurlock headed the official Comic-Con Frazetta Tribute panel this year where he reiterated the prior days announcement by famed film director Robert Rodriguez, that Rodriguez’ Quick Draw Productions are producing a series of major motion pictures based on Frazetta creations and that the Frazetta Museum will move from East Stroudsburg PA to Austin, TX. Frazetta’s son Bill Frazetta, appeared at the Vanguard Publishing booth in support of the Vanguard Frazetta Classics line and Spurlock and Steranko joined the Frazetta family, Frazetta Management, Rodriguez and others at a VIP Frazetta party hosted by Rodriguez which exhibited about $20 million worth of Frazetta oil paintings. Vanguard also premiered new deluxe editions of their Frazetta Johnny Comet and Frazetta White Indian collections.
